Kekurangan Menggunakan Bahasa Pemrograman Golang
Apa keuntungan menggunakan bahasa pemrograman Golang? Sebagai permulaan, ia memiliki lebih banyak kekuatan. Inilah alasan mengapa banyak perusahaan multinasional lebih suka menggunakan bahasa ini. Saat ini, hampir semua perusahaan besar mempekerjakan programmer untuk menulis program mereka. Dibutuhkan programmer yang dapat menulis program secara efisien dan dapat menyelesaikan segala macam masalah yang dihadapi perusahaan. Karena itu, jika Anda memiliki keterampilan seperti itu, Anda dapat dengan mudah menemukan pekerjaan di perusahaan besar.
Keuntungan kedua menggunakan bahasa ini adalah ia memiliki perpustakaan fungsi dan kata kunci yang luas yang banyak digunakan oleh programmer di seluruh dunia. Karena itu, menulis program untuk semua jenis bisnis dapat dilakukan dengan mudah. Karena Golang menggunakan beberapa bahasa pemrograman paling populer, Anda tidak perlu mempelajari bahasa lain untuk menggunakan bahasa ini. Selain itu, karena bahasa pemrograman ini memiliki dukungan yang sangat besar, ada banyak alat yang tersedia untuk programmer Golang.
Namun, salah satu keuntungan menggunakan bahasa pemrograman Golang adalah fleksibilitasnya. Seorang programmer tidak perlu terbiasa dengan semua fitur dari setiap bahasa pemrograman. Dia hanya perlu tahu yang dasar. Misalnya, dia hanya perlu tahu tentang pointer dan tipe.
Salah satu keuntungan terbesar menggunakan bahasa ini adalah sangat mudah dipelajari. Golang memanfaatkan pembuatan kode yang sederhana namun efektif. Tidak seperti C++, tidak perlu menggunakan fungsi virtual untuk dapat membuat program yang efisien. Hasilnya adalah programmer mampu membuat program yang efisien tanpa harus memahami kode pemrograman yang rumit. Selain itu, karena Golang memiliki tipe data yang sederhana, mudah digunakan dan dipelihara.
Keuntungan ketiga dari belajar dan menggunakan bahasa ini adalah ia memiliki banyak perpustakaan. Ada ratusan ribu library yang bisa diakses melalui Golang seperti std lib, math library, dan theurses library. Semua perpustakaan ini membuat pemrograman lebih mudah. Selain itu, pustaka standar sangat berguna bagi mereka yang tidak terbiasa dengan bahasa pemrograman.
Itulah beberapa keuntungan menggunakan bahasa pemrograman golang. Ini telah digunakan oleh banyak programmer di seluruh dunia karena kesederhanaan dan efisiensinya. Mempelajari bahasa ini pasti akan memberikan manfaat yang sangat besar bagi programmer.
Ada beberapa kelemahan menggunakan bahasa pemrograman ini juga. Salah satu kelemahan ini adalah fakta bahwa itu tidak mendukung penggunaan abstraksi tingkat tinggi. Faktanya, bahasa pemrograman ini sangat terbatas dalam hal abstraksi yang diperbolehkan untuk digunakan. Misalnya, pengguna tidak diizinkan membuat fungsi yang melakukan banyak tugas. Lebih jauh, satu fungsi dapat didefinisikan juga tetapi kemudian hanya dalam lingkup global yang berarti bahwa fungsi yang didefinisikan di dalam program yang sama akan terlihat di program lain juga.
Kelemahan lain dari bahasa ini adalah belum dirancang untuk portabel. Ini berarti bahwa ini bekerja dengan baik pada sistem operasi utama seperti Windows dan Linux tetapi tidak bekerja dengan baik pada Mac atau IBM-PC. Karena ini adalah bahasa sumber terbuka, ada kemungkinan mengalami bug. Juga, seorang programmer yang menggunakan bahasa ini harus menyadari keterbatasan alatnya. Karena sifatnya yang open source, programmer Golang dapat dimintai pertanggungjawaban atas bug yang mungkin tidak dia sadari.
Baca Juga :
- Pemberdayaan Anak-Anak Desa Ononamolo Talafu Kabupaten Nias Berbasis Rumah Belajar Terintegrasi Smart Application
- Mahasiswa PHP2D UMA Melaksanakan Pemberdayaan Kelompok Perempuan Nelayan Berbasis Digital Mother School Di Desa Bawolowalani Nias Selatan
- Mahasiswa Magister Agribisnis UMA Sebagai Duta Petani Milenial Republik Indonesia 2021
Tag:bahasa pemrogaman go, bahasa pemrograman, bahasa pemrograman gojek, bahasa pemrograman pemula, bahasa pemrograman terbaik, bahasa pemrograman untuk pemula, belajar bahasa pemrograman, belajar bahasa pemrograman go, belajar golang, belajar golang bahasa indonesia, belajar pemrograman golang, golang, kekurangan bahasa pemrograman kotlin, kekurangan pemrograman kotlin, pemrograman, pemrograman golang, tutorial golang bahasa indonesia, tutorial pemrograman golang

